Railway Line UXO Detection and Survey

Before construction of new railway infrastructure or undertaking maintenance activities along existing lines, it is imperative to conduct thorough Unexploded Ordnance (UXO) detection and survey operations. These surveys aim to identify and assess the risk posed by potential UXO remnants, which could include ordnance from past conflicts or military activities. A comprehensive methodology typically involves utilizing a combination of geophysical techniques such as metal detectors, walk-over surveys by trained personnel, and in certain cases, excavation for confirmation. The goal is to create a detailed map of potential UXO locations and assess the severity of the risk they present to workers and the public. In light of the survey findings, appropriate mitigation measures may be implemented, ranging from controlled detonation to careful disposal of identified UXO.
